About

Historic Greek Orthodox church situated in the village of Ippeio with accessible parking. The church is a cultural and spiritual landmark featuring traditional religious ceremonies, particularly notable for the Saint Prokopios celebrations that draw both local devotees and visitors seeking authentic village religious life.

What to expect

The church sits quietly at the heart of Ippeio village, a living place of worship where the scent of incense and the sound of Byzantine chant give visits a genuinely devotional atmosphere. The feast of Saint Prokopios draws both the local community and visitors together in a celebration that connects present-day village life with centuries of Orthodox tradition — worth timing a visit around if you can.

Best time to visit

The feast of Saint Prokopios on July 8th is the most atmospheric time to visit; otherwise, late spring and early autumn offer pleasant weather for exploring the village.

How to get there

Ippeio is roughly 15–20 minutes by car from Mytilene, heading north along the eastern coast road. The church has parking available on site.
